Featuring a brick interior with it's historic location downtown in a Old German Restaurant's legendary building. Handcrafted beer is a favorite in the culturally home of U. of Michigan. Wood-fired pizzas, fresh pastas, wood-grilled steaks, burgers, soups and salads. The on-site brewery is a seven-barrel system installed by Alan Pugsly of England. The brick-sided, copper-topped brew kettle faces the sidewalk, and patrons can watch beer being brewed from the street or from inside the dining room. A Michigan Wine Restaurant serving a selection of Michigan wines.
